Imagine this: you’ve poured your heart and soul into crafting amazing content, but it’s languishing in the search engine wilderness, unseen by your target audience. This isn’t just frustrating; it’s a missed opportunity. Getting your pages indexed quickly is crucial for visibility and ranking. Accelerating this process requires understanding the underlying issues and implementing effective solutions. This means addressing the factors that contribute to slow indexing times.
One of the first places to look is your website’s architecture. A poorly structured site can significantly hinder search engine crawlers. Are your sitemaps up-to-date and correctly formatted? A broken or missing sitemap can leave pages undiscovered. Similarly, errors in your robots.txt
file can inadvertently block crawlers from accessing important content. Furthermore, a weak internal linking structure can create "siloed" content, making it difficult for crawlers to navigate and index all your pages. Ensure your internal links are logical and relevant, guiding crawlers through your site’s content efficiently.
Google Search Console is your best friend in this process. The Coverage report provides a detailed overview of your site’s indexing status, highlighting any errors or warnings. Use the URL Inspection tool to analyze individual pages and identify specific indexing problems. For example, you might discover that a page is marked as "submitted URL removed" or "indexed, though blocked by robots.txt". Addressing these issues directly can significantly improve your indexing speed.
Finally, don’t overlook the importance of server performance and website speed. A slow-loading website will frustrate users and search engine crawlers. A sluggish server can impact how quickly crawlers can access and process your pages. Optimizing your server and improving your website’s overall speed will not only enhance user experience but also contribute to faster indexing times. Consider using tools like Google PageSpeed Insights to identify areas for improvement.
Conquer Crawl Delays
Getting your pages indexed quickly is crucial for search engine visibility. A slow indexing process can significantly hinder your organic reach, leaving your valuable content buried beneath the waves of the SERPs. This means fewer visitors, less engagement, and ultimately, a smaller return on your SEO investment. Accelerating this process requires a strategic approach that focuses on optimizing your website for search engine crawlers. Let’s explore how to get your content seen faster.
One of the most effective ways to speed up indexing is through meticulous XML sitemap implementation. A well-structured XML sitemap acts as a roadmap for search engine bots, guiding them directly to your most important pages. Think of it as a VIP pass, granting crawlers priority access to your freshest and most relevant content. Tools like Google Search Console offer excellent resources for creating and submitting sitemaps, ensuring your website’s structure is clearly communicated to Googlebot and other crawlers. Regularly updating your sitemap is key, especially after significant content updates or structural changes. Failing to do so can lead to pages being missed entirely, hindering your ability to improve slow indexing times.
Next, we need to ensure that your robots.txt
file isn’t inadvertently blocking access to crucial pages. This file acts as a gatekeeper, controlling which parts of your website are accessible to search engine crawlers. A poorly configured robots.txt
can inadvertently prevent crawlers from accessing important content, leading to delays in indexing and potentially lost traffic. Carefully review your robots.txt
file to ensure that it’s not accidentally blocking access to essential pages. Remember, clarity and precision are paramount here. A single misplaced directive can have significant consequences.
Website architecture plays a pivotal role in crawl efficiency. A well-organized website with a logical internal linking structure makes it easier for crawlers to navigate and index your content. Think of your website as a city; a well-planned road system (internal links) allows for easy navigation, while a chaotic sprawl makes it difficult to find your way around. Strategic internal linking helps distribute link equity, boosting the authority of your important pages and signaling to search engines which content is most valuable. Prioritize linking relevant pages together, creating a clear hierarchy that reflects the structure of your website.
Finally, website speed and server response time are paramount. A slow-loading website frustrates users and hinders crawlers. A sluggish server response time means that crawlers will spend more time waiting for your pages to load, reducing their overall crawl efficiency. Optimize your website’s loading speed by compressing images, minimizing HTTP requests, and leveraging browser caching. Investing in a reliable hosting provider with fast server response times is also crucial. Tools like Google PageSpeed Insights can help you identify areas for improvement and track your progress. Remember, a fast-loading website benefits both users and search engine crawlers, contributing to a smoother and more efficient indexing process.

Craft Irresistible Content
High-quality content is the cornerstone of any successful SEO strategy. Think beyond keyword stuffing; focus on creating truly valuable, insightful pieces that naturally attract backlinks. For example, an in-depth guide on a niche topic, supported by original research and data, is far more likely to be linked to by other authoritative websites than a thin, poorly written article. Consider the user experience – is your content easy to read, navigate, and understand? Is it visually appealing and mobile-friendly? These factors contribute to a positive user experience, which in turn signals to search engines that your content is valuable.
Amplify Your Reach
Creating great content is only half the battle. You need to actively promote it to ensure search engines and your target audience discover it. Leverage the power of social media platforms like Twitter, LinkedIn, and Facebook to share your content with a wider audience. Engage with your followers, respond to comments, and participate in relevant conversations. Consider guest blogging on reputable websites within your industry; this not only exposes your content to a new audience but also helps build your brand authority.
Build Authoritative Backlinks
Backlinks are like votes of confidence from other websites. They signal to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y. Focus on building high-quality backlinks from authoritative websites within your niche. This is far more effective than acquiring numerous low-quality backlinks from irrelevant sources. Reach out to influencers and bloggers in your industry and propose collaborations or guest posting opportunities. Analyze your competitors’ backlink profiles to identify potential link-building opportunities. Remember, quality over quantity is key.
